What is print-through?

What is print-through? Here are some definitions.

Noun
  1. A weak imprint of magnetic information transferred to adjacent layers of audiotape, resulting in an unwanted echo.

Postprint, or post-echo, is when the print-through signal follows the recorded signal.
Until 3M introduced the 900 Series of tapes, the rule was the better the tape is in terms of high signal-to noise ratios, the more potential there is for print-through.
